Position Summary: The DOT Truck Driver operates Class A air-braked equipped combination vehicles to and from Retail and Donation sites in a safe and efficient manner. Class B vehicles also available.

 

Salary: $25.75 per hour 

 

Schedule: This position works 4/10s (Four, 10-hour work days)

 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:The DOT Truck Driver responsibilities Includes the following and other duties as assigned: 

  • Drives diesel powered tractor with 27’ or 53’ trailer between distribution center, retail stores and donation centers.   
  • Backs up trailer to loading dock.  
  • Places stairs against the back of the trailer to load items into trailer.  
  • May place chains on tires in snowy weather. 
  • No touch freight 
  • Class B, transport compactors and dumpsters to landfill or transfer station 

Daily Vehicle Inspection 

Complete daily pre/post trip inspections and maintenance checks; ensures that all aspects of vehicle operation and material handling are done according to proper safety procedures. Responsible for vehicle’s equipment and for reporting repair needs. 

 Follows Safety Procedures 

Adheres to all Goodwill and FMCSA safety regulations; reports all safety hazards, incidents, and accidents immediately. 

 Customer Satisfaction 

Build and maintain good rapport and relationships with customers and clients.

Qualifications/Basic Job Requirements:

  • CDL Class A or Class B
  • 3 - 6 months of related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Current Medical Examiners Certification (DOT Physical)
  • All offers of employment are contingent upon the receipt of a background check report, which may include a review of the applicant’s driving record and drug screening, as deemed acceptable by Goodwill.
  • Commercial Truck Driver Career Education Program is preferred, HS diploma or GED preferred
